I further investigated the problem.
I think that the problem is due to circular import statements among my .eol files.
If I am correct with my diagnosis, the performance problem is not due to the online validation task.
Finally, also increased the memory allocated to my eclipse instance but if I am correct with my diagnosis, it does not solve the problem by itself. It only delay the inevitable java memory exception.
-vmargs
-Dosgi.requiredJavaVersion=1.7
-Xms2048m
-Xmx4096m
However, I still suffer from EPSILON editor performance issues if I try to edit EPSILON files after failed executions of EPSILON tasks. I will further investigate this issue as well and come back with solutions if any.
